That pretty much sums it up. If I am overclocking and it gets to hot, for whatever reason, what really happens? I am guessing worst case is it burns up my chip... but what generally happens? I have read sometimes it seems the computers lock up or shutdown, is this normal or just, you got lucky type thing? Just curious 🙂

Like you guessed, an overclocked system that is overheating tends to either shutdown, lock up, or slow down first.

It is possible to burn a cpu up but it usually takes extra voltage as newer chips are designed to handle quite a bit of heat.
